To Our CourseStorm Community,

The events of the last several weeks have deeply saddened us at CourseStorm, and we stand in solidarity with the Black community in being outraged at systemic, ongoing abuses of power. We have taken time to gather, reflect, and discuss how our team can be part of creating a more just future for all. We understand that we need to start by recognizing our own privileges and how we have benefitted from racism, as well as our responsibility to undo it. 

As a company with a mission to streamline access to education, we firmly believe that education is vital to a more socially just world. While refusing to be silent is an important first step, we also recognize that it is more important to take meaningful action. Our commitment will not only be in words but in actions as well. 

With that in mind, we are committed to:

  • Amplifying the educational opportunities offered by our customers who, through their organizations and classes, are working for social justice.
  • Financially supporting organizations and individual classes that address systemic racism and work to end discrimination in all its forms.
  • Annual training for our staff to recognize and combat discrimination, and strengthening our company anti-discrimination policy.
  • Actively recruiting to build a diverse staff, advisors, and board.

We recognize that these steps at CourseStorm are simply a beginning and that we have a long way to travel. We are committed to continuing this work, and I believe firmly that through our actions, we can and will make a difference.
